Citigroup's Gun Policy Reversal: What You Need to Know

Citigroup's recent decision to reverse its long-standing gun control policy has sent shockwaves through the financial world and ignited intense debate. For years, the banking giant was lauded for its relatively strict stance on firearm manufacturers, but now that stance has softened, leaving many questioning the implications. This article delves into the details of Citigroup's policy change, examines the reasons behind it, and explores the potential consequences.

A Shift in Strategy: From Restrictions to Engagement

Previously, Citigroup had adopted a restrictive approach to financing firearm manufacturers, limiting its involvement in the industry. This policy aligned with growing public concern about gun violence and the social responsibility of large corporations. However, the bank recently announced a significant change, stating it will no longer actively restrict its lending to gun manufacturers. This reversal represents a major shift in Citigroup's approach to Environmental, Social, and Governance (ESG) investing.

Why the Change? Understanding Citigroup's Rationale

The precise reasoning behind Citigroup's decision remains somewhat unclear, but several contributing factors have been suggested:

  • Pressure from Shareholders: Some analysts believe pressure from shareholders who prioritize short-term profits over ESG concerns played a significant role. The argument is that limiting involvement in the firearms industry may have negatively impacted the bank's financial performance.
  • Competitive Landscape: With other major financial institutions maintaining more flexible gun policies, Citigroup may have felt compelled to adapt to remain competitive. A stricter policy could have put them at a disadvantage in attracting clients and securing profitable deals.
  • Evolving Legal Landscape: Changes in legal frameworks surrounding ESG investing and corporate social responsibility might have influenced Citigroup's reassessment of its gun policy.

The Implications of Citigroup's Decision

The consequences of this policy change are far-reaching and multifaceted:

  • Impact on Gun Control Advocacy: Gun control advocates are understandably concerned, viewing this move as a setback for efforts to reduce gun violence through corporate pressure. This reversal could embolden other financial institutions to adopt similar policies, potentially undermining previous progress.
  • Financial Market Reactions: The stock market's reaction to this announcement will be a key indicator of investor sentiment regarding ESG factors and their influence on corporate decision-making.
  • Reputation and Brand Image: Citigroup's decision may impact its brand image and reputation among consumers who value social responsibility. This could lead to a loss of customers who support stricter gun control measures.

Looking Ahead: What to Expect

The aftermath of Citigroup's policy reversal will be closely watched by investors, activists, and policymakers alike. It highlights the ongoing tension between maximizing shareholder value and upholding corporate social responsibility, especially in controversial sectors like firearms manufacturing. The long-term effects on the gun industry, the financial sector, and public perception of ESG investing remain to be seen.
